Book Description
This textbook offers an introduction to 3D computer modeling and
Pro/ENGINEER. The intent of this textbook is to help students
become comfortable working in 3D. Although there are numerous
step-by-step examples to illustrate modeling concepts and
techniques, this is not a push-button manual.
The textbook begins with 3D modeling basics including 3D
modeling methods and model definitions, coordinate systems, and
view types and specifications. It then proceeds with the creation
of 3D components, the documentation of those components for
production, and the combining of components into assemblies.
End-of-chapter exercises vary in difficulty from easy to
challenging. The exercises provide a chance to review basic
concepts as well as increase understanding and modeling skills by
applying those concepts and techniques to the creation of some
realistic models.
